Valtteri Bottas Disguises Himself as Iconic Simpsons Character to Win $18.06 Prize During Bicycling Event in Colorado

Alfa Romeo driver Valtteri Bottas surprised everyone recently by competing in a bicycle race dressed as “Duffman“. Duffman is one of the characters from the famous animated series called The Simpsons. Since the Finnish driver is a fan of beer himself, he chose to dress up as Duffman, the mascot and chief spokesperson for Duff Beer in the animated series and ended up winning an $18.06 prize, the case of beer in Colorado, according to unknownbrewing.com.

Following his race, the 33-year-old also won a prize and that was his weight in beer. Bottas decided to donate all the beer to the people attending the SBTGRVL event. SBT GRVL p/b Wahoo is one of the most prominent gravel races in the world, which takes place in Colorado.

Bottas impresses everyone by donning Duffman’s outfit

During F1’s summer break, Valtteri Bottas traveled to Steamboat Springs in Colorado to take part in the bicycling event. Over there, he competed in the SBT HLL CLMB, a difficult bicycle race that takes place through the mud.

The Finnish F1 driver, who is also a fan of racing on two wheels, completed 100 miles in the event. Even though he cramped a lot after the drive, he believes it was all worth it.

Bottas noted that he enjoys pushing himself beyond the limits, and this was just one such opportunity when he could do so. He believes that pushing himself just gives him a new perspective on life.

Valtteri Bottas will next take part in the Dutch GP

After finishing his break in the United States, Valtteri Bottas will return to track later this weekend for the Dutch Grand Prix. The race weekend at Zandvoort will take place from August 25 to 27.

As for Bottas, he will hope to have a strong weekend, having struggled throughout this season. The Finnish driver is currently 15th in the championship and has scored just five points.

Even though he is a point ahead of Alfa Romeo teammate Guanyu Zhou, the 33-year-old would have hoped for more considering his years of experience. However, since the 2023 season has only just passed the halfway stage, Bottas will have many more races to prove that he still has what it takes to compete at the highest level.
